Who is Deion Jones?

  • Deion Jones is a linebacker who plays for the Atlanta Falcons in the NFL
  • In his rookie season, Jones went all the way to the Super Bowl, losing in overtime to the Patriots
  • In 2019, he signed a 4-year contract extension with the Falcons worth $57m

Deion Jones is an American football linebacker who plays in the NFL for the Atlanta Falcons. He was drafted in the 2016 NFL Draft by the Falcons in the second round, as the 52nd overall pick. 

Jones was born in New Orleans, Louisiana on 4th August 1994, and did his high schooling at Jesuit High School there. After graduating as a three-star recruit Jones committed to Louisiana State to play his college football for the Tigers between 2012-2015. In his senior year, Jones enjoyed a flourishing campaign with the Tigers recording a hundred tackles, five sacks, two interceptions, three passes defended, and a forced fumble. He was named a finalist for the Butkus Award that year and declared for the 2016 NFL Draft shortly after.

Jones was picked up by the Atlanta Falcons on 5th May 2016 on a 4-year rookie contract worth $4.54 million that included $2.16 million guaranteed and a signing bonus of $1.50 million.

He made his NFL debut and first career start in the season opener against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ers in a 31-24 loss, recording six tackles in that game. He finished his Russian campaign with 108 tackles (75 solo), 11th pass deflections, three interceptions, and two touchdowns in the 15 games he played of which 13 were starts. The Falcons make the playoffs that year, and Jones made his playoff debut in the NFC divisional round win against the Seattle Seahawks, in which he recorded five tackles broke up a pass, and made an interception. His rookie season ended with a heartbreaking 28-34 overtime loss to the New England Patriots in the Super Bowl LI.
